Amy Packham has secured an acquittal for rape on behalf of a vulnerable client who waited 3 years for the outcome.
In cross examination the first complaint witness admitted that the complainant had told her that she had wanted to be alone with the defendant and was attracted to him. She also admitted that the complainant had asked her not to tell the police certain things, because ‘it might make it all look very different’. The complainant had denied really important aspects of the defence case which the complaint witness agreed for the first time in court.
